华文绘本如何能促进代际对话?教育工作者与儿童文学作家,钱冰韵,通过精心挑选的绘本,将分享亲子共读如何搭建孩子与成人之间的情感桥梁、培养同理心,并在共同阅读体验中深化对华语的感知与热爱。
How can Chinese picture books spark conversations between generations? Educator and children’s author Beverly Qian shares how thoughtfully chosen picture books can connect children and adults, nurture empathy, and inspire a deeper appreciation for the language through shared reading experiences.
This session will be conducted in Chinese.

钱冰韵 Beverly Qian Bingyun (Singapore)
钱冰韵(Beverly Qian) 是新加坡儿童文学作家及华文教育工作者。她擅长创作幽默可爱、充满童趣的故事,让孩子在轻松阅读中感受华文的魅力。她拥有教育硕士学位,既是了解孩子的教育者,也是热爱讲故事的创作者。冰韵是「小书勺工作室(Little Book Scoop)」的联合创始人,其创作的《神奇书店》系列,陪伴许多新加坡孩子快乐学习中文。
Beverly Qian (钱冰韵) is a Singapore-based children’s author and Chinese language educator. She creates stories that spark imagination and help children connect with the Chinese language in joyful ways. Holding a Master of Education (Early Childhood), she combines pedagogical insight with a love for storytelling. She is the co-founder of Little Book Scoop (小书勺工作室) and author of the Magical Bookstore (神奇书店) series.
Ames Chen (Singapore)
On the work front Ames is a trained humanities teacher and children’s book author. But she enjoys her job mothering her 3 children most of all. She writes stories for them and other children like them, because she firmly believes in the power of the next generation to effect change.
